Peabody Energy Balance Sheet Health
Financial Health criteria checks 6/6
Peabody Energy has a total shareholder equity of $3.5B and total debt of $312.4M, which brings its debt-to-equity ratio to 8.9%. Its total assets and total liabilities are $5.7B and $2.2B respectively. Peabody Energy's EBIT is $750.1M making its interest coverage ratio -28. It has cash and short-term investments of $855.7M.

Financial Position Analysis
Short Term Liabilities: BTU's short term assets ($1.9B) exceed its short term liabilities ($805.0M).
Long Term Liabilities: BTU's short term assets ($1.9B) exceed its long term liabilities ($1.4B).
Debt to Equity History and Analysis
Debt Level: BTU has more cash than its total debt.
Reducing Debt: BTU's debt to equity ratio has reduced from 40.7% to 8.9% over the past 5 years.
Debt Coverage: BTU's debt is well covered by operating cash flow (245.9%).
Interest Coverage: BTU earns more interest than it pays, so coverage of interest payments is not a concern.
